Gauge versus absolute. A tyre gauge reading 32 psi means 32 psi above atmospheric, which is about 46.7 psi absolute. Converting the number is straightforward; remembering which zero it was measured from is where the mistakes happen. N/mm² and MPa are the same size, so a drawing quoting either is quoting the same stress. Worked examples
A car tyre: 886 inH₂O in kilopounds per square inch
A car tyre comes to about 886 inH₂O. Multiplying by the factor: 886 × 3.61273e-05 = 0.0320088 ksi. Dividing the answer back by 3.61273e-05 returns the figure you started with, which is the quickest way to check you have the factor the right way up.
A steam boiler: 4010 inH₂O in kilopounds per square inch
Take a steam boiler, roughly 4010 inH₂O. The conversion is a single multiplication — 4010 × 3.61273e-05 — giving 0.14487 ksi. Because the relationship is proportional, doubling the input doubles the answer to 0.289741 ksi.

How many kilopounds per square inch are in one inch of water?
Exactly 3.61272905497e-05. Every figure on this page is that one number multiplied by your input, so the only rounding is at the display step.
What is the formula to convert inches of water to kilopounds per square inch?
kilopounds per square inch = inches of water × 3.61272905497e-05. Reversed, inches of water = kilopounds per square inch ÷ 3.61272905497e-05, which is the same as multiplying by 27,679.9058214.
Which is the bigger unit, the inch of water or the kilopound per square inch?
The kilopound per square inch. One inch of water is only 3.61273e-05 of a kilopound per square inch, so it takes 27,679.9 inches of water to make one kilopound per square inch.
What does this quantity actually measure?
Both units measure pressure. That is why a single factor is enough: there is no temperature offset and no material property involved, unlike conversions that cross between different quantities.

Is there a quick way to do inH₂O to ksi in my head?
Plenty of people do this in their head: divide by 28,000 instead of using the exact factor 0.000036. At 100 that shortcut gives 0.0035714286 kilopounds per square inch, off by 0.000041 kilopounds per square inch or about 1.14%. Fine for a rough estimate, not fine for anything you are cutting to size or dosing.
